    We own a 2022 Berkshire XL 37A, class A diesel pusher. On our last outing we had a leak coming…read morethrough the AC intake in the bedroom. The only water source is the AC unit on the roof at the rear of the coach which happens to be above the bedroom. I immediately suspected a clogged drain line. Supporting that suspicion was the lack of condensation build-up coming out of the drain line (the front AC unit was draining just fine). Although this can be an easy DIY fix, I am a senior and still recovering from a terrible ladder accident/fall so going up on the roof was not an option for me. I called a mobile RV repair service and they quoted me a minimum of $600 for the repair. A person at the RV storage facility we use suggested I call American RV Service Center. I called last week and spoke to Morgan. She was very helpful but initially said her next opening was in August. I told her we are going on an outing July 22nd. She said she would see what she could do to get us in before then. After a few minutes she came back on the line and told me because it was presumably a simple fix she could get me in Friday the 19th. She advised me they charge $175 an hour and it shouldn't take more than 2 hours. Today (the 19th) they got our coach in. The tech found there was no clog, the line was clear. He did find that the drain hose connected to the pump did not have a clamp securing it. He put a clamp on it, confirmed that the pump was working and then tested the system. With the bedroom AC unit on for a while, the system began draining the condensation build up, operating normally. No leaking inside. Problem fixed. Morgan was great to work with throughout this process. They went above and beyond to get us taken care of knowing we have an outing planned. The temps will be in the triple digits where we're going and having both AC units working will be a life saver! Their service costs are fair and their customer service was excellent. Also, it's nice to call a business and have a live person answer. I highly recommend American RV Service Center!!! Thank you Morgan and thank you tech (unfortunately I did not get his name).
